When a Samsung Galaxy or similar Exynos-powered phone suffers a catastrophic system failure (a "hard brick"), it cannot access the standard Android operating system or the user-facing Download Mode. The silicon chip defaults to its core boot ROM behavior: . In this low-level state, the device acts as a client waiting for direct system instructions, necessitating the 4.0.0.0 port driver to interface with PC software. 2. Low-Level Firmware Flashing

Windows requires a specific driver to interpret this hardware ID. Without it, Device Manager displays a yellow exclamation mark labeled "Exynos Usb Device-4.0.0.0" or "Unknown Device."

Developed by SEC, SYSTEM LSI (Samsung Electronics Corporation's System Large Scale Integration division), this specific port/serial driver baseline bridges the gap between Windows operating systems and Exynos chips running in Emergency Download (EUB) or hardware testpoint modes. It serves as a vital component for firmware engineering, device diagnostics, unbricking procedures, and mobile forensics. Comprehensive Driver Breakdown
